Key Responsibilities Client Education & Professional Interactions:

Friendly engagement with clients via phone, email and in person, to retrieve data, provide timely follow-ups, and ensure all required information has been collected from client in coordination with completing their specific Estate Plan.

Document Preparation:

Utilize estate planning software to generate accurate documents based on client preferences, drafting any additional ancillary documents, and ensuring all necessary details are captured before review by team attorneys.

Case Management:

Organizing and maintaining case and client files within the practice management system to effectuate 60-day signing goals and 30-day drafting goals, along with tracking deadlines and managing calendars as they relate to upcoming deadlines and signings.

Client Service:

Assist with clients as needed, including serving as witness and/or notary to document execution, scanning and processing client documents, preparing correspondence and filings, etc.

Trust Funding Guidance:

Support clients by providing instruction in coordinating asset transfers and ensuring proper trust funding for a fully implemented estate plan.

Value Communication:

Confidently discuss the estate planning process with clients, overcome objections, and clearly communicate the value of completing their estate plans.
